This is a list of noted Ugandan writers, born or raised in Uganda, whether living there or overseas, and writing in one of the languages of Uganda.

Contents

A

  • Adong Judith, playwright
  • Grace Akello (1950–), poet, essayist, folklorist and politician
  • Harriet Anena, short story writer, poet, journalist
  • Apolo Kagwa (1864–1947), prime minister of Buganda
  • Monica Arac de Nyeko (1979–), short story writer, poet and essayist
  • Asiimwe Deborah GKashugi, playwright
  • Lillian Aujo, poet, short story writer
  • B

  • Doreen Baingana, short story writer
  • Bake Robert Tumuhaise, novelist, inspirational writer
  • Evangeline Barongo, children's writer
  • Violet Barungi, (1943-), novelist, editor
  • Mildred Barya, poet
  • Jackee Budesta Batanda, short story writer, novelist
  • Austin Bukenya (1944–), poet, literary theorist, actor and playwright
  • Busingye Kabumba, (1982-), lawyer, poet
  • Bwesigye bwa Mwesigire, (1987-) lawyer, poet, short story writer
  • Ernest Bazanye, journalist, author
  • D-K

  • Dilman Dila (1977–), novelist, short story writer, filmmaker
  • Angella Emurwon, playwright
  • Arthur Gakwandi (1943-), novelist, academic, short story writer
  • Jessica horn-Uganda (1979-), poet
  • Ife Piankhi, poet
  • Moses Isegawa (1963–), novelist
  • Kabubi Herman, poet
  • Kagayi Peter, poet
  • Keturah Kamugasa, writer and journalist
  • James Kityo Ssemanda, Poet, Novelist
  • Catherine Samali Kavuma (1960–), novelist
  • China Keitetsi (1967–), autobiographical writer
  • Susan Nalugwa Kiguli, poet, academic (1969-)
  • Barbara Kimenye (1929–2012), children's writer
  • Wycliffe Kiyingi (1929–2014), playwright
  • Henry Kyemba (1939–), politician and writer
  • Goretti Kyomuhendo, novelist (1965-)
  • L-M

  • Beatrice Lamwaka, short story writer
  • Bonnie Lubega (1929–), novelist, children's writer and lexicographer
  • Lubwa p'Chong (1946–1997), playwright.
  • Jennifer Nansubuga Makumbi, poet, novelist, short story writer
  • Irshad Manji (1968–), author, professor and advocate
  • Charles Mayiga (1962–), lawyer, prime minister of Buganda (2013-)
  • Rose Mbowa (1943–1999), playwright, actress and educator
  • Jane Musoke-Nteyafas (c.1976–), poet and writer
  • Mutesa II of Buganda (1942–1969), Kabaka of Buganda
  • Christopher Henry Muwanga Barlow (1929–2006), poet
  • Mahmood Mamdani (1933–), academic and political writer
  • Patrick Mangeni, academic and writer
  • Mulumba Ivan Matthias (1987–), poet, short story writer, novelist
  • N-O

  • John Nagenda (1938–), writer and presidential adviser
  • Nakisanze Segawa, poet
  • Beverley Nambozo, poet, short story writer
  • Glaydha Namukasa, novelist
  • Peter Nazareth (1940–), novelist, playwright, poet and critic
  • Rajat Neogy (1938–1995), writer and editor
  • Jason Ntaro, poet
  • Richard Carl Ntiru (1946–), poet
  • Michael B. Nsimbi (1910–1994), Luganda writer
  • Nyana Kakoma, short story writer
  • Julius Ocwinyo (1961–), editor, poet and novelist
  • James Munange Ogoola (1945-), poet, judge
  • Okello Oculi (1942–), novelist, poet and academic
  • Okot p'Bitek (1931–1982), poet
  • Mary Karooro Okurut (1954-), novelist, academic, politician
  • Charles Onyango-Obbo (1958-), journalist
  • S-Z

  • Andrew Rugasira, author, businessman
  • Rose Rwakasisi (1945-), children's writer, short story writer
  • Eneriko Seruma (1944–), poet, novelist and short story writer
  • Robert Serumaga (1939–1980), playwright, director and novelist
  • Taban Lo Liyong (1939–), Sudan-born poet and critic
  • Bahadur Tejani (1942–), Kenyan-born poet, dramatist and literary critic
  • Lillian Tindyebwa, novelist, short story writer
  • Tumusiime Rushedge (1941-2008), novelist, cartoonist, surgeon
  • Nick Twinamatsiko, engineer, novelist, poet
  • Hilda Twongyeirwe, editor, poet, short story writer
  • Ayeta Anne Wangusa (1971-), activist, novelist, short story writer
  • Timothy Wangusa (1942–)
  • Yoweri Museveni (1944-), politician, president
  • Samuel Iga Zinunula, poet
  • Elvania Namukwaya Zirimu (1938–1979)
  • Pio Zirimu (died 1977), linguist and literary theorist
